Recently, tech giant Meta (formerly Facebook) announced a new round of layoffs affecting over 1,000 employees. The cuts primarily target its Reality Labs division, which is responsible for developing metaverse-related technologies, including vir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R) products. Although Meta has heavily invested in the metaverse in recent years—positioning it as a core driver of future growth—the business segment has yet to become profitable and faces challenges such as high R&D costs and limited market adoption.CEO Mark Zuckerberg stated that the company needs to improve operational efficiency and focus on its most strategically valuable initiatives. This latest round follows major layoffs in 2022 and 2023 and is part of ongoing efforts to optimize resource allocation, control costs, and accelerate the shift toward high-potential areas like artificial intelligence (AI). Notably, Meta has significantly increased its AI investments recently, launching several AI-powered products and services to maintain its competitive edge.Analysts note that while the metaverse vision is ambitious, companies must prioritize short-term financial performance and sustainability in the current economic climate. Meta’s decision reflects its attempt to balance long-term strategy with immediate pressures. How successfully it can integrate AI and metaverse development will be crucial to its ability to lead innovation in the years ahead.
